You might wonder why stainless steel is special. Stainless steel is made from iron and at least 10.5% chromium. Some groups say it should have at least 11% chromium. The chromium makes a thin, invisible layer on top. This layer can fix itself if it gets scratched. So, stainless steel does not rust or corrode easily, even in hard places.
Stainless steel has more than just iron and chromium. Makers add other things to make it better. Here is what you will find in stainless steel:
At least 10.5% chromium
Iron is the main part
Nickel helps it bend and stops it from oxidizing
Molybdenum gives it more strength and stops rust
Carbon, silicon, manganese, phosphorus, sulfur, and titanium help in different ways
Each part helps stainless steel be strong, last long, and stay clean. You use these good things every time you use stainless steel at home or work.
You may wonder how stainless steel is different from regular steel. The answer is in what is inside and what it does. Regular steel, also called carbon steel, is mostly iron and carbon. Stainless steel has chromium and sometimes nickel, which changes how it works.
Here is a simple table to show the difference:
Material | Major Alloying Elements |
|---|---|
Stainless Steel | Iron, Chromium, Nickel, and others |
Carbon Steel | Primarily Carbon |
Stainless steel is better because it does not rust or get damaged by heat. The chromium makes a shield, so you do not worry about stains or rust. Nickel helps make it easy to shape and join. Regular steel does not have these good points. It rusts fast and needs more care.
Stainless steel is less magnetic and easier to keep clean. You see it in food factories, hospitals, and places that need to be clean. Regular steel is good for building and cars but needs help to stop rust.

Corrosion resistance is the best thing about stainless steel. You want things that last and do not rust. Stainless steel does this because it has chromium. When air touches stainless steel, chromium makes a thin layer on top. This layer keeps water, air, and chemicals away from the metal.
If you scratch it, the layer fixes itself. This means stainless steel stays strong even if it gets hurt. More chromium means better protection from rust. That is why stainless steel is good for wet or salty places.
Here is a table that shows how stainless steel fights rust:
Mechanism | Description |
|---|---|
Chromium Oxide Layer | Makes a shield on the surface when it meets air, stopping rust and damage. |
Self-Healing Property | If the shield breaks, chromium makes it again when air is around. |
Higher Chromium Content | More chromium means better rust protection. |
You can see how stainless steel does in different places. The rust rates stay low, even in tough spots:
Type of atmosphere | Corrosion rates (mpy) | Comments |
|---|---|---|
Rural | 0.20 – 0.39 | Measured in Eastern and Western Europe |
Urban | 0.39 – 1.18 | |
Industrial | 1.18 – 2.36 | |
Marine | 0.39 – 1.57 | Measured after 4 years in Scandinavia |
Arctic | 0.16 | Measured after 4 years in northern Sweden |
304 stainless steel rusts only about 0.03 mm each year. This is much less than carbon steel, which rusts fast. Stainless steel works well in cities and near the sea. It is great for bridges, boats, and things outside.

Heat resistance is another great thing about stainless steel. You need things that can take heat and not get weak. Stainless steel keeps its shape and strength when it gets hot. That is why people use it for ovens, engines, and big machines.
Different types of stainless steel can take different heat levels. Here is a table that shows how much heat some types can handle:
Grade | Temperature Range (°F) | Melting Point (°F) | Notes |
|---|---|---|---|
304 | 1,598 - 1,697 | 2,550 - 2,650 | Gets weaker at very high heat |
316 | Slightly lower than 304 | 2,500 - 2,550 | Better at fighting rust than 304 |

You want things that are strong and last long. Stainless steel is very strong and tough. It can hold heavy things and does not bend or snap easily. This makes it good for buildings, bridges, and hospital tools.
Here is a table that shows how strong some types are:
Stainless Steel Grade | Tensile Strength (ksi) | Yield Point (ksi) |
|---|---|---|
303 | 75-90 | 30-40 |
304 | 75-90 | 30-40 |
Tensile strength means how much pull it takes to break. Yield point is when it starts to bend. Stainless steel is strong and lasts a long time, so it is safe for big jobs.

Stainless steel has many types. Each type is good for certain jobs. You can pick the best one if you know what each does well.
Austenitic stainless steel is used in lots of places. It has a face-centered cubic (FCC) structure. This type is not pulled by magnets. You can bend and shape it without much effort. It has the best corrosion resistance of all types. You see it in kitchen sinks, food machines, and medical tools. It is strong and keeps a clean surface. You can weld it easily. It costs more, but it works very well.
Tip: Pick austenitic if you want stainless steel that does not rust and is easy to keep clean.
Ferritic stainless steel has a body-centered cubic (BCC) structure. It is magnetic. It gives good corrosion resistance, but not as much as austenitic. Use ferritic stainless steel where you do not need the highest protection. It costs less and is easy to cut and shape. It is harder to weld and not as tough as austenitic.
Here is a table to compare ferritic and austenitic stainless steel:
Feature | Ferritic Stainless Steel | Austenitic Stainless Steel |
|---|---|---|
Crystal Structure | Body-centered cubic (BCC) | Face-centered cubic (FCC) |
Magnetism | Magnetic | Non-magnetic |
Corrosion Resistance | Good, but lower | Superior |
Ductility and Toughness | Lower | Higher |
Weldability | More challenging | Better |
Cost | More cost-effective | More expensive |
Applications | Less demanding environments | High-performance applications |
You find ferritic stainless steel in car exhausts, kitchen tools, and building trims. It is good for heat exchangers and food work because it handles heat and is easy to clean.
Martensitic stainless steel is known for being very hard. You can make it even harder with heat. It has more carbon, so it is strong but can break more easily. It gives medium corrosion resistance, not as high as the other types. You see martensitic stainless steel in tools and parts that must stay sharp or strong.
Here are some main features of martensitic stainless steel:
Very hard
Can break more easily
Medium corrosion resistance
High tensile strength
You use martensitic stainless steel for knives, surgical tools, engine parts, and pumps. It is good when you need a sharp edge or strong wear resistance.

Big companies use stainless steel for many reasons. In hospitals, you see it in tools for surgery and dental work. Doctors use it for fake joints too. Stainless steel does not react with body fluids. This keeps patients safe. Hospitals use it for tables and MRI machines. It is easy to make these things clean.
Car makers use stainless steel in exhaust pipes and car frames. You also see it in ship containers and trucks. It is great for places near the sea. Rust is a big problem there. Stainless steel does not rust, so cars and ships last longer.
Industrial Sector | Common Applications |
|---|---|
Food and Catering | Kitchen tools, forks, pots, fridges, dishwashers |
Medical | Surgery tools, dental tools, implants, hospital tables |
Energy and Heavy Industry | Machines in chemical, gas, oil, and green energy plants |
Automotive and Transport | Car exhausts, car parts, ship containers, trucks, garbage trucks |
Construction | Wall covers, inside uses, building frames |
Stainless steel is used on boats and oil rigs too. It is strong and stands up to bad weather. In buildings, you see it on walls and in frames. Stainless steel is strong and can be recycled. This helps make safe and long-lasting buildings.
